Dental implant surgery - Mayo Clinic Dental implant surgery replaces tooth roots with metal, screwlike posts and replaces damaged or missing teeth with artificial teeth that look and work much like real ones Dental implant surgery can be a helpful choice when dentures or bridgework fit poorly This surgery also can be an option when there aren't enough natural teeth roots to support dentures or build bridgework tooth replacements

Dental Implant Procedure: What to Know - Healthline Dental implant procedures require multiple steps over a period of around 3 to 9 months You may need the help of several types of dental specialists, including a periodontist and oral surgeon
Dental Implants: Surgery, Purpose Benefits - Cleveland Clinic Dental implants are a common surgical tooth replacement option They provide support for artificial teeth like crowns, bridges and dentures Dental implant placement may require a few procedures and several months of healing But once an implant heals, you can use it just like a natural tooth With proper care, your implant can last a lifetime
Dental Implants - StatPearls - NCBI Bookshelf A dental implant is one of the treatments to replace missing teeth Their use in the treatment of complete and partial edentulism has become an integral treatment modality in dentistry Dental implants have a number of advantages over conventional fixed partial denture
